Rystad Energy, Afreximbank Are Official Partners Of Invest In African Energy In London

The African Energy Chamber (AEC) – the voice of the African energy sector – is proud to announce that multinational energy market research firm, Rystad Energy, and leading pan-African financial services provider, the African Export-Import Bank (Afreximbank), have been confirmed as the official partners for the Invest in African Energy New Year Reception, taking place at the Waldorf Hilton luxury hotel in London on 26 January 2023.

The Invest in African Energy reception serves to drive European investment across Africa’s burgeoning energy environment and comes at a critical time for Africa’s energy sector. While the continent boasts an estimated 125.3 billion barrels of crude oil, 620 trillion cubic feet of gas and untapped renewable energy potential, and Europe continues to seek alternative energy supplies as the bloc diversifies away from Russian oil and gas, the New Year reception will unite global business leaders, investors and government representatives to explore new investment and energy trading opportunities between the African and the European markets.

Rystad Energy, having served as the official intelligence partner for AEW 2022 and now for the Invest in African Energy event, continues to play a crucial role in driving investment across the African energy market through the provision of state-of-the art market intelligence. Rystad Energy’s timely and in-depth analysis of both Africa and global energy market trends has and will continue to be crucial for providing European investors with the information they need to make informed decisions with regards to increasing investment to fast-track energy addition in Africa while supporting a just and inclusive energy transition. As a partner for the Invest in African Energy Reception, Rystad Energy will help expand the discussion on investing in Africa’s energy future while facilitating new deals and partnerships on the back of market intelligence.

Meanwhile, as a key driver of African energy sector expansion and a facilitator of Africa’s trade finance sector, Afreximbank’s partnership will help unlock and enhance private-public sector collaboration as well as Africa-Europe investment ties. Having served as the official partner for the 2022 edition of the AEC’s annual energy event, African Energy Week (AEW) – Africa’s premier event for the oil and gas sector which saw $2 billion worth of deals signed to grow Africa’s energy sector – as partner of the Invest in African Energy Reception, the Afreximbank, alongside the AEC, is set to usher in a new era of stronger energy developments on the back of optimal capital flow across the continent’s oil and gas sector. With both Afreximbank and the AEC pushing ahead with the creation of the African Energy Bank to improve financing across the continent’s energy spectrum, the Invest in African Energy event provides an opportunity for the two to network, interact and sign partnership deals with European hydrocarbon financiers and global multilateral investment institutions to fast-track both the creation of the bank and energy developments across the continent.

“The Chamber is so proud to have partnered with both Rystad Energy and Afreximbank for the Invest in African Energy event in London where more deals are expected to be signed that will drive African oil, gas and energy developments. We believe that improved cooperation with parties such as Rystad Energy, Afreximbank and European investors as well as platforms such as the Invest in Africa event will continue to be key to making energy poverty history across the African continent a reality by 2030,” stated NJ Ayuk, the Executive Chairman of the AEC.

Through its high-level, investment-dedicated panel discussions, exclusive networking and deal signings, the Invest in African Energy event will serve as a prelude for the 2023 edition of AEW – the official meeting place for African energy policymakers and key stakeholders and investors – which will take place from 16 – 20 October in Cape Town.
